WebJambalaya is a cajun recipe originating in Louisiana made with rice, celery, peppers and onion; with chicken and smoked or spicy sausage like Andouille. Shrimp is often added, too. WebJambalaya is a Louisiana-origin dish consisting of meat and vegetables mixed with rice. Traditionally, the meat is sausage of some sort along with chicken. WebINSTRUCTIONS. 1 Heat oil in large heavy skillet on medium-high heat. Add chicken and sausage; cook and stir 5 minutes. Remove from skillet. 2 Stir onion into skillet; cook and stir on medium heat 2 minutes or until onion is softened. Stir in Seasoning. Return chicken and sausage to skillet. 3 Stir in broth and tomatoes; bring to boil. Stir in rice.

WebNext, add the sausage, chicken, bell peppers, onion, jalapeños, chicken broth, tomatoes, minced garlic, Cajun seasoning, and salt and pepper to greased slow cooker and stir to combine. Cover and cook the jambalaya for 3-4 hours on low. Stir in the rice and cook another 1-2 hours until rice is fully cooked and tender.
